利用PHP访问带有密码的Redis方法示例

网络编程 2025-03-13 14:45www.168986.cn编程入门

解锁Redis的密码保护:PHP与Redis的亲密互动

在信息安全日益重要的今天,为Redis设置密码已成为标配操作。本文将指导你如何设置Redis密码,并通过PHP进行访问。让我们一起进入Redis的世界,深入了解如何操作。

一、为Redis设置密码

打开你的redis.conf配置文件,定位到requirepass字段。在此字段后添加你的密码,例如:requirepass yourpassword。这样就为Redis设置了验证密码。启动redis客户端并尝试连接服务器时,会发现虽然可以登录,但无法执行命令。这时,使用授权命令进行授权即可。命令为:auth yourpassword。

二、PHP访问带密码的Redis

在PHP中访问带密码的Redis,首先需要建立连接并认证。示例代码如下:

$redis = new Redis();

$conn = $redis->connect('localhost', 6379); //连接到Redis服务器

$auth = $redis->auth('yourpassword'); //进行认证

var_dump($auth); //输出认证结果

一旦认证成功,你就可以开始使用Redis的各种功能了。例如:

$redis->set('aess_token', "123213213213213213"); //设置key 'aess_token' 的值

$redis->set('expired_time', ); //设置key 'expired_time' 的值

然后,你可以通过get方法获取这些key的值:

var_dump($redis->get("aess_token")); //获取并输出key 'aess_token' 的值

var_dump($redis->get("expired_time")); //获取并输出key 'expired_time' 的值

以上,就是关于PHP访问带密码的Redis的全部内容。希望本文能对你的学习或工作有所帮助。如果你有任何疑问,欢迎留言交流。在信息安全日益重要的今天,掌握这些知识将对你大有裨益。让我们一起学习,共同进步。本文由狼蚁网站SEO优化提供,更多优质内容,敬请关注。如果你发现这篇文章对你或你的团队有所帮助,不妨分享给更多的朋友,让更多人受益。

上一篇:AngularJS基础 ng-src 指令简单示例 下一篇:没有了

Copyright © 2016-2025 www.168986.cn 狼蚁网络 版权所有 Power by